The streets were bountiful with the heavy foot traffic of its citizens, mostly salarymen and salarywomen dashing for their atypical desk jobs, making the usual rounds in the street whether by foot or public transport. Within this dense forest of people, you mindlessly went about your day listening to the sound of music that drowned the marching patter of the crowd around you. Social media has been a great distraction from the drab, skimming through your Whistler page for any news on the home front. Musatafu was filled with many adventures. One day you pass by a minor fight in the streets between local heroes and thugs, and another you find yourself marvelling at the result of a bank heist thwarted by major Pro-Heroes that headlined once in a while. But nothing compared to the large city billboards that decorated the largest intersection in Musatafu, highlighting the best of the best. It was mostly for endorsements, yet you couldn't help but smile at the coolly-collected grin of Musatafu's most infamous hero rising - Paragon.

As of late, he had garnered much attention on his rising stardom in the city - nothing less coming from the son of the city's most recently proclaimed Number One, Endeavour. Watching the billboards swap to his image was always a pleasant moment in your morning stroll, and yet a tone caught your ear from your phone. It looked to be a Whistle from the Pro-Hero himself:

Wish me luck! But I really don't need any against the bird-brain :P

With already over thousands of likes, it was no surprise you were late to the announcement. Much of the hype behind Paragon was his application to rise in rank, soon to outdo the current Number Two, Hawks. It was common knowledge that the two were in cahoots with one another, but were competitive all the same, especially now with Paragon eyeing to take Hawks' place. To think that two of the youngest Pro-Heroes in the major leagues were equal to Endeavour and even All Might.

It was inspiring.

"Hey, slowpoke!" called out your friends ahead of the crosswalk. "Come on, we're going to miss it!"

"Ah, coming!" You chimed back, hopping through the crowd to join your pack of friends. A ruffle of your uniform caught you unawares while you pat down the crinkles that showed. UA was coming to a close in your chapter of your life, now with the advent of offers being sent left, right and center. Many of your friends within the social circles had already a handful or a few, some already with their mind set on where they were headed.

You on the other hand had no clue. Or rather had no way of making a decision. Your bag carried all the offers that had reached out to you for that first step into the Pro-Hero circuit, yet one letter had yet to be opened, still sitting amongst others who had written lofty proposals. Its insignia still bore into your mind, anticipatory and nervous all the same with the worry laced in your brow.

What if...

What if you weren't accepted into the one agency you hoped to be a part of?

What if... you missed your chance to work with him?
